Special Forces – Behind Enemy Lines is an action/adventure game.

Publisher’s description “Dr. Phlan, a mad man obsessed by the idea of controlling the world, has gathered a large army of a very sophisticated robots which he has invented himself. He also constructed a number of facilities to produce chemical weapons which he intends to use against who oppose his plans. Your task as a special forces member is to attack these facilities, destroy them and eliminate Dr. Phlan’s robots before Dr. Plan can realize what is going on.

Game Play: During the game you will have five different missions to accomplish. Follow the missions and you should achieve the goal. In some of the missions you have to use a tank to attack others in a fierce battlefield. In some other cases you should use a helicopter to move across the river. Use your intuition as a soldier to achieve your goal.

You have three types of weapons: Gun, Bazooka, and Grenade. While you ride a tank, then you can use its firing power. Sometimes you should use some oil.
This game uses the number keys:
On CDMA QWERTY phones:  lock the keyboard in number mode by pressing the Fn key twice.
On iDEN QWERTY phones:  lock the keyboard in number mode by doing a long press on the  Fn key.

‘4’ or ‘LEFT’: Move the player to the left.
‘6’ or ‘RIGHT’: Move the player to the right.
‘5’ or FIRE: Shoot.
‘2’ or ‘UP’: Move the player forward.
‘8’ or ‘DOWN’: Move the player backward.
‘1’: Move the player up and left.
‘3’: Move the player up and right.
‘7’: Move the player down and left.
‘9’: Move the player down and right.
‘0’: Change the weapon that the player is using. You can switch between gun, bazooka, bombs and grenades.
‘*’: Enable the player to get into or get out of a nearby vehicle. The vehicle can be a tanker or a helicopter.
‘#’: gets you to the main menu!
